Filmmakers talk about their passion and we make and custardy popovers.

Two Columbus filmmakers Joshua Clark and Mike Kash talk about what drives their passion. Learn about learn about a photographer who was one of the minds behind the Black is Beautiful movement. And we head back into the kitchen with the Riffe Gallery's Cat Sheridan to make popovers and learn about the Columbus gallery.
